Access to a piano is critical for any music student. A piano allows students visualize the music they are learning on their instrument, and understand how chords, harmonies, bass lines, rhythm, and melodies work together to create music.
During distance learning, this is even more crucial. Our students are eager to continue developing their skills on their band instruments, but instruction will be limited due to the pandemic. That’s why providing students with economical, quality keyboards is necessary to continue to develop their talents.
By purchasing these keyboards, you will be clearing a barrier to a young person becoming a musician, story teller, and culture creator. These keyboards have built in speakers, so they can be played immediately, and they also can be connected to a computer, for easy recording and arranging.
Our students will earn access to these keyboards by demonstrating respect for the class and their classmates. Should students want to keep their keyboard after they graduate, they will have the opportunity to fundraise and work to buy it from the school. Once they pay for it, the school can replace it. This will teach the students about agency, responsibility, and hard work, as well as create a steady stream of quality keyboards for our students to use for years to come.
